BURBAR v. INCORPORATED VILLAGE OF GARDEN CITY

No. 2:13-CV-01350 (ADS)(ETB).

961 F.Supp.2d 462 (2013)

Jacob BURBAR, Plaintiff, v. INCORPORATED VILLAGE OF GARDEN CITY, Garden City Police Department, Garden City Police Officer Rocco A. Marceda, Garden City Police Officers John Doe #1 and John Doe #2, The County of Nassau, and the Nassau County District Attorneys Office, Defendants.

United States District Court, E.D. New York.

August 19, 2013.


Attorney(s) appearing for the Case

Law Offices of Robert Klugman by Robert Klugman, Esq. , of counsel, Garden City, NY, Flanzig and Flanzig, LLP by Daniel Flanzig, Esq. , of counsel, Mineola, NY, for the Plaintiff.

Cullen and Dykman, LLP by Cynthia A. Augelo, Esq. , of counsel, Garden City, NY, for the Defendants Incorporated Village of Garden City, Garden City Police Department and Garden City Police Officer Rocco A. Marceda.

Office of the Nassau County Attorney by Andrew Kenneth Preston , Deputy County Attorney, Mineola, NY, for Nassau County.


MEMORANDUM OF DECISION AND ORDER

SPATT, District Judge.

On October 9, 2012, Jacob Burbar (the "Plaintiff") filed this action in Supreme Court of the State of New York, Nassau County. On March 14, 2013, the state action was removed by the Defendant Incorporated Village of Garden City on the basis of federal question jurisdiction.
